ISI is the Initial Spread Index; which factor does it most closely relate to?

Explanation:
Initial Spread Index measures how fast a small fire would spread in its early stages. It is driven mainly by how quickly flames can preheat and ignite fuels ahead of them, which is most directly affected by wind and slope. Strong winds push heat and flames toward unburned fuel and increase oxygen supply, while an uphill slope causes heat to rise and preheat fuels upslope, both speeding up initial spread. Fuel moisture, humidity, and ambient temperature influence fire behavior, but ISI specifically reflects the impact of wind and slope on the early rate of spread, not moisture-related effects or temperature alone. That’s why the best choice is wind and slope.
